The preventative maintenance process for New Hope solar systems typically spans 2-3 hours for a standard 6-8 kW residential array and includes five distinct phases: visual panel inspection under raking light to spot micro-fractures, thermal imaging to detect hot spots indicating shading or cell degradation, inverter voltage and frequency testing, DC string testing with a solar multimeter to measure amperage and voltage output, and documentation of findings in your maintenance log. What's Included in Our Solar Panel Preventative Maintenance

  • Full visual panel inspection using raking light to identify micro-fractures, delamination, and junction box corrosion-20-minute thorough walkthrough of your entire New Hope roof layout
  • Thermal infrared imaging of all panels to detect hot spots, voltage stress, and shading losses-captured in digital report format you can access anytime
  • DC string voltage and amperage testing with calibrated solar multimeter for each circuit on your system-identifies underperforming strings before they trigger inverter faults
  • Inverter diagnostics including AC output waveform analysis, grid voltage compliance, and firmware version confirmation-ensures your inverter meets New Hope utility interconnection standards
  • Grounding and bonding continuity testing to verify equipment is safely bonded per Texas electrical code section 705.7
  • Performance baseline documentation comparing your system's output to expected kWh based on New Hope's average 220 clear-sky days per year
  • Written maintenance report with photos, thermal images, test results, and prioritized recommendations-valid for 12 months for permit and warranty documentation

Signs You Need Solar Panel Preventative Maintenance in New Hope

  • System output declining 3-5% year-over-year despite no change in roof shading-indicates panel soiling or micro-fractures common in New Hope's pollen season
  • Inverter display showing error codes or frequent resets during mid-afternoon peak generation hours when New Hope rooftop temperatures exceed 165 degrees
  • White mineral crusting on the south-facing panels-North Texas hard water deposits that reduce light transmission by up to 8% and require specialized cleaning
  • Birds or rodents nesting beneath your racking system-a frequent issue in New Hope's wooded subdivisions near Lake Lavon
  • Visible caulking degradation or cracks around flashing where roof penetrations meet your rail system-allows water infiltration and corrosion
  • AC breaker tripping intermittently on hot afternoons-often caused by inverter capacitor aging or loose connections that preventative maintenance catches before failure

Our Solar Panel Preventative Maintenance Process in New Hope

1

Initial Inspection & Thermal Imaging

Our technicians arrive within 48 hours of your New Hope service request. We spend 45 minutes performing a complete visual walkthrough of your panels, racking, and electrical connections, then use FLIR thermal imaging cameras to scan all panels for hot spots. This step takes approximately 30-40 minutes and produces a detailed thermal map saved to your maintenance file.

2

Electrical Testing & Performance Verification

Using calibrated solar multimeters and clamp meters, we test DC voltage and current on each string, verify AC output at the inverter, and test grounding continuity. This typically requires 20-30 minutes and ensures your New Hope system meets Texas electrical code 2020 standards. We compare your current output to your system's baseline performance rating.

3

Cleaning & Caulk Assessment

If mineral deposits or pollen are detected, we perform deionized water cleaning using soft-bristle brushes and pure water rinse-no harsh chemicals that degrade panel coatings. This phase takes 45-60 minutes for a typical New Hope residential system and can restore 4-7% efficiency loss. We also assess caulking around all roof penetrations and flashing.

Recent Solar Panel Preventative Maintenance Project in New Hope, Texas

In June 2024, we completed a comprehensive preventative maintenance service on a 7.2 kW residential system installed in 2016 at a home in Ridgeview Estates, New Hope. The 24-panel array showed a 6.8% efficiency decline year-over-year despite no new shading issues. Our thermal imaging revealed three panels with junction box corrosion and micro-fractures from a hail event the previous April. After deionized water cleaning, grounding testing, and inverter diagnostics, we identified a loose MC4 connector on string two that was causing a 12% voltage drop. Total service time was 2.5 hours, and the homeowner's system recovered to 98.5% of rated capacity. Our preventative approach identified an issue that would have triggered a $3,200 inverter replacement within 18 months if left unaddressed.
